About General Conference

The 180th Semiannual General Conference of the Church will be held on Saturday and Sunday, October 2-3, 2010. The Saturday general sessions will begin at 12:00 p.m. and 4:00 p.m.with the general priesthood meeting to be held on Saturday, 8:00 p.m. ; Sunday sessions will be held at 11:30 a.m. (which includes Music and the Spoken Word) and 4:00 p.m.

The First Presidency invites all members of the Church to participate by attending, viewing, or listening via television, radio, satellite, or Internet transmission at www.lds.org. Messages of inspiration and guidance will be delivered by the First Presidency, members of the Quorum of the Twelve Apostles, and other General Authorities and general officers of the Church.
